In case you’ve missed the memo or you’re not on the list for the memos, Sun ‘n Fun starts today. The official details are April 13th through the 18th at Lakeland Linder Regional Airport (KLAL) in Florida. It is one of the larger fly-in air shows and I’m sure fun will be had by all who attend. The first resource to consider, as with most things, is the actual event website. This can be found at http://www.sun-n-fun.org/. The site has event schedules, multimedia, and other information regarding the fly in. It looks like they will post the show daily newspaper. Regardless, it is the first place to look for information on what’s happening at Sun ‘n Fun. You can also check out their Facebook page at: http://www.facebook.com/pages/Sun-n-Fun/112938012053332.
Another great place to follow goings on is Twitter. There are two hash tags that are established related to Sun ‘n Fun: #NotAtSnF and snf10. You can also follow the Twitter user @SunnFunFlyIn for official tweets. Please also consider following @snfradio, @snfradiodave and @LiveATC for the latest on the Sun ‘n Fun radio station and live internet streaming. The LiveATC stream of the Sun ‘n Fun radio station can be found at http://www.liveatc.net/SnFLive or by searching on KLAL on LiveATC.net. There are also streams for the Lake Parker Arrival and KLAL Tower so you can listen to aircraft arrivals.
For even more, check your favorite aviation podcasts. The UCAP guys are confirmed for two live podcasts on the radio station. They can be found at uncontrolledairspace.com. Another podcast to follow is the Pilots Flight Podlog. Will and Dave will be posting quickcasts during the week which are usually great. You can find them at pilotsflightpodlog.com.
